Brand | Megazyme | |
Approvals | AOAC Method 997.08, AOAC Method 2000.11, AOAC Method 2016.06, GB Standard 5009.245-2016 and GB Standard 5009.255-2016 | |
EC Number | endo-Inulinase: 3.2.1.7, exo-Inulinase: 3.2.1.80 | |
Enzyme | Fructanase | |
Storage Conditions | Storage Temperature: Below -10°C Stability: > 1 year under recommended storage conditions. Check vial for details | |
Formulation | Supplied as a lyophilised powder | |
Physical Form | Powder | |
CAS Number | 9001-57-4, 9025-67-6, 37288-56-5 | |
CAZy Family | GH32 | |
Synonyms | endo-inulinase: 1-beta-D-fructan fructanohydrolase exo-inulinase: fructan β-fructosidase | |
Source | Aspergillus sp. | |
Expression | From Aspergillus sp. | |
Specificity | endo-Inulinase: endo-acting hydrolysis of (2,1)-β-D-fructosidic linkages in inulin. exo-Inulinase: Hydrolysis of terminal, non-reducing β-D-fructofuranoside residues in β-D-fructofuranosides. | |
Unit Definition | endo-Inulinase: One Unit of endo-inulinase activity is defined as the amount of enzyme required to release one μmole of β-D-fructose reducing-sugar equivalents per minute from inulin (20 mg/mL) in sodium acetate buffer (100 mM), pH 4.5. exo-Inulinase: One Unit of exo-inulinase activity is defined as the amount of enzyme required to release one μmole of β-D-fructose reducing-sugar equivalents per minute from kestose (5 mg/mL) in sodium acetate buffer (100 mM), at pH 4.5 at 40°C. | |
Temperature Optima (°C) | 40 | |
pH Optima | 4.5 | |
